Fault Memory and Retrieval

If the Controller senses a fault on one of the output
solenoids, it will flash the machines diagnostic Lamp (Reel
Diagnostic lamp on console or green Diagnostic lamp
under console) and store the fault into the Controllers
(ECU) memory. The fault can then be retrieved and viewed
with the Diagnostic ACE hand held tool or a lap top/PC at
anytime. The Controller will store one (1) fault at a time
and will not store another different fault until the first fault
is cleared.
Retrieving Fault Information
Retrieving Stored Faults (Do not sit in seat)
1. Rotate ignition key to Off position.
2. Connect the Hand held Diagnostic Tool to the desired
Controller Loopback Connector (use the proper
overlay).
3. Move the Joystick to the Raise position and hold.
4. Rotate ignition key to On position, and continue to hold
the Joystick in Raise position until the top left
Diagnostic Tool light comes on (approx. 2 seconds).
5. Release the Joystick to the center position.
6. Hand held Tool will now playback the fault retained in
the Controller memory.
Important
The display will show eight (8) individual
records with the fault displayed on the 8th record. Each
record will be displayed for 10 seconds. Be sure to have
the Diagnostic Tool display on Outputs to see fault. The
Problem circuit will be flashing. Records will repeat until
key is turned off. Unit will not start in this mode.
Clearing the Fault Memory (Diagnostic Tool not
required)
1. Rotate ignition key to Off position.
2. Turn Backlap Switch to the Front or Rear Backlap
position.
3. Turn the Reel Control Switch to Enable position.
4. Move the Joystick to the Raise position and hold.
5. Turn the ignition key to On, and continue to hold the
Joystick in the Raise position until the Reel Control
Lamp starts to flash (approx. 2 seconds).
6. Release the Joystick and turn the Key Off. Memory is
now cleared.
7. Turn the Backlap Switch to Off and Enable Switch to
Disable position.
Important
The Diagnostic ACE display must not be
left connected to the machine. It is not designed to
withstand the environment of the machine's every day use.
When done using Diagnostic ACE, disconnect it from the
machine and reconnect loopback connector to harness
connector. Machine will not operate without loopback
connector installed on harness. Store Diagnostic ACE in
dry, secure location in shop, not on machine.
